A short-lived drive-in which opened on August 6, 1954 with John Wayne in “Reap the Wild Wind”. It was closed following a fire on September 27, 1954, which destroyed the concession and projection building. It was reopened on June 7, 1956.
In 1957 it was renamed Starview Drive-In and closed in 1961.

Exactly one month after its opening, the Grand Forks Drive-In suffered destruction from a fire, which estimated a loss of $10,000 after the fire destroyed both its concession stand and projection booth on the afternoon of September 27, 1954.
The Grand Forks Drive-In reopened on June 7, 1956 featuring CinemaScope installations. It was renamed the Starview Drive-In the following year, and closed in 1961.
